DTC U0100/65 Lost Communication with ECM/PCM
CIRCUIT DESCRIPTION
The ECM sends signals such as engine speed signal, transmission signal, shift position signal, L4 switch
signal, TC terminal signal (diagnosis mode signal) to the suspension control ECU, etc. when the air suspen-
sion system is in operation.
DTC No.DTC Detecting ConditionTrouble Area
U0100/65
The suspension control ECU detects the following conditions
simultaneously:
1. Ignition switch ON
2. Vehicle speed signal is more than 30 km/h (18.5 mph)
3. No communication from ECM continues for more than 3
seconds
ECM
Suspension control ECU
Communication circuit
INSPECTION PROCEDURE
HINT:
This circuit uses CAN for communication. Therefore, if there are any malfunctions in the communication cir-
cuit, one or more DTCs in the CAN communication system is/are output.
1 Go to CAN communication system (See page DI±1065).

DTC U0122/67 Lost Communication with Translate ECU
CIRCUIT DESCRIPTION
The translate ECU sends signals such as vehicle wheel speed signal, TS terminal signal (test mode signal)
to the suspension control ECU, etc. when the air suspension system is in operation.
DTC No.DTC Detecting ConditionTrouble Area
U0122/67
The suspension control ECU detects the following conditions
simultaneously:
1. Ignition switch ON
2. No communication from translate ECU continues for more
than 3 seconds
Translate ECU
Suspension control ECU
Communication circuit
INSPECTION PROCEDURE
HINT:
This circuit uses CAN for communication. Therefore, if there are any malfunctions in the communication cir-
cuit, one or more DTCs in the CAN communication system is/are output.
1 Go to CAN communication system (See page DI±1065).

Height Control Indicator Lamp Circuit
CIRCUIT DESCRIPTION
The height control indicator lamp indicates the target height, not the actual height.
It blinks when the height control is operated by pressing the height control switch and stays on when the
operation is completed.
